“SUPERB PIZZA FROM THE RED TENT
Honestly one of the best pizzas I've had in all of Los Angeles. You'll find it on a side street off of Laurel canyon across from the bank of America parking lot.
Everything is fresh and house made, from the natural sourdough crust with no commercial yeast, to the simple and superb sauce. The cheese was especially delicious and the whole pizza comes together so deliciously that it could come from a high end restaurant.
That's because the chef/owner previously worked in high end fine dining and is obsessed with making the best -- and he does! He's justifiably proud of his work and will happily explain his process and let you watch your pizza cook in his portable wood-fired oven.
The menu includes specials or a choose-your-own topping choice starting at $11.
Each pizza is generously sized and enough for two unless you want leftovers, which you do!
There's an outdoor table and stools so you can enjoy it hot out of the wood fired oven.
all together a delightful experience and pizza you will want to return for!
TIP: Call before you go to make sure he's there. Sometimes, such as on especially hot days, he chooses not to set up. But he always answers his phone, so you can also order in advance (though the pizza takes only about three minutes to cook in his 700 degree oven.
